Some Like It Wicked
Teresa Medeiros

Reviewed by Suan Wilson
Posted July 19, 2008

Romance Historical

Catriona Kincaid left the Highlands after her parents were murdered by English soldiers. Her brother packed her off to England and the safety of English relatives. Catriona has lived off their charity never forgetting her Scottish roots. Like her father before her, Catriona dreams of Scottish independence. When her uncle demands she marry and forget the Highlands, Catriona plots to marry a man she hasn't seen in years. He currently resides in debtors' prison, and Catriona believes for the right price he'll marry her and accept her conditions.

Once a naval hero, Sir Simon Wescot discovered he was unable to live up to the legend that grew around his feat. The famous deed occurred when Simon stumbled accidentally saving the life of his commander. Simon cut a wide path as a notorious libertine with no cares in the world. As the bastard child of a cold duke who despises him, Simon loves the irritation that his reputation causes the duke. Languishing in prison, Simon is astounded when Catriona arrives with a proposition.

Catriona adored and idolized the charming young naval officer she met years ago. She's followed his disreputable career believing he's worth saving. Catriona offers him her generous dowry if he takes her back to Scotland. The trip proves illuminating and love flickers between them. However, if not nourished, it will die leaving both of them bereft.

Favorite romance author Teresa Medeiros spins a memorable tale of girlhood dreams colliding with a man who believes he has nothing to offer. From the first page, readers will become engrossed in the characters and their struggles as their dreams crash down into reality.

SUMMARY

Some like it dangerous . . .

Highland beauty Catriona Kincaid cares nothing for propriety—or even her own safety—when she storms the grounds of Newgate Prison. Determined to return to Scotland and restore her clan's honor, she seeks the help of Sir Simon Wescott, a disgraced nobleman and notorious rogue. She is prepared to offer him both wealth and freedom, but she never dreams the wicked rake will be bold enough to demand a far more sensual prize.

Some like it seductive . . .

Simon is shocked to discover the tomboy he met long ago has blossomed into a headstrong temptress. Although he's sworn off his dreams of becoming a hero, he can't resist playing knight errant to Catriona's damsel in distress. Both adventure and peril await them at her Highland home, where they will risk their lives to vanquish her enemies . . . and risk their hearts to discover a passion beyond their wildest dreams.
